Web-разработка. С чего начать?
1809 повідомлень
#14 років тому
Цитата ("morbo12"):для моих html'ек поднимать-то практически ничего не надо: sudo aptitude install apache2
а дальше можно погуглить, доустановить и конфиг порулить
Для html-ек вообще нужен голый браузер. Хотя это в винде, в дебиане хз. В общем, тут пошла плавать

А вообще получается, не совсем уж "знаний нет никаких"


Цитата ("morbo12"):
вопрос возник исходя из следующих моих данных: грубо говоря пхп распространён, имеется большое количество готовых решений, с другой - встречал много критики в его адрес; с руби ситуация обратная: удобен, но малораспространён. отсюда и вопрос насколько целесообразно его изучение в ключе фриланса
Может оказаться, что это именно будет Вашим козырем. Если нравится руби, считаете его удобным, хорошим и т.д., то далее все в Ваших руках. Продумайте преимущества руби перед php, в частности, для аргументации заказчику. Единственно, не знаю, насколько много специалистов по руби есть, т.е. может ли получиться так, что таких желающих тоже вагон, и все что-то заказчикам убедить пытаются

Ну так поизучайте и этот вопрос заодно.
11416 повідомлень
#14 років тому
С чего начать,какова последовательность изученияhtml, css, javascript
какой язык выбрать
PHP достаточно распространен и прост, изучить можно быстро, пользуется спросом. Насчет руби - спрос маленький, стоимость больше.
какие cms использовать
Тут кому что больше нравится... Кто-то пишет с нуля, кто-то использует фреймфорки, я например делаю сайты-визитки на Wordpress - очень удобная и простая для освоения заказчиками cms
источники фундаментальных знаний
Ну это однозначно гугл... Ищите, читайте, пробуйте... Хабрахабр уже посоветовали

наверняка ещё что-то важное не спросил
Да, еще почитайте о фрилансе... Свободы как таковой по сути то и нет, работать приходится в разы больше чем в офисе и не пинать балду а именно работать.
Это сложно и многие не справляются, особенно бывает сложно получить первый заказ. Хотя мне повезло и взял его сразу и дальше пошло поехало.
А в целом это смелый шаг... Удачи...
1649 повідомлень
70 повідомлень
#14 років тому
Учите руби. Спрос есть и очень хороший.Выберите любой opensource проект и старайтесь в него коммиты делать.
По поводу что читать - регистрируйтесь на github.com и читайте чужой код,читайте апи,пишите тесты.
на хабре в горе мусора не каждый день достойная статья появляется.
2817 повідомлень
#14 років тому
Учите паскаль, не начинайте с рнр - хоть будете в курсе что существуют типы данных.Можно походить в какой нибуть универ где лекции читают, посидеть, послушать

Для руби надо хотя бы один год программировать, чтобы въехать что там и как.
70 повідомлень
#14 років тому
Глупость. В руби очень низкий порог вхождения, просто в процессе изучения и работы придется понять многие хитрые вещи но для того что б начать что-то писать- не надо знать ни паскаль ни тем более пхп(после пхп кстати люди годами не могут переключиться)
70 повідомлень
#14 років тому
kirilev, в процессе разбора реальных проектов - всему научится, тут вопрос упорства.
7 повідомлень
#14 років тому
Цитата ("kirilev"):Vasiletc, Цитата ("morbo12"):знаний нет никаких
здесь я немного обманул - есть навыки процедурнго программирования(pascal), базовые знания html, css
5330 повідомлень
#14 років тому
Цитата ("MaratMaratMarat"):а Вы действительно хотите заниматься разработкой под web? Почему именно под web, а не разрабатывать десктопные приложения? Я к чему спрашиваю: действительно ли Вам нравится образ жизни за компьютером и стезя разработчика?
у меня тоже подобные вопросы... почему не работа фрезеровщика? они получают на уровне профи прогеров. газовым сварщиком быть круто, там зарплатки от 4 тыс баксов.
с чего вдруг веб?
70 повідомлень
#14 років тому
Может ему еще разрешения спрашивать ?не бухает в подворотне - и то молодец.
5330 повідомлень
#14 років тому
Цитата ("Vasiletc"):Может ему еще разрешения спрашивать ?
нет, но как то отсутствие хоть какой либо предрасположенности к точным наукам и логическому мышлению...
знаете. больше всего напрягает другое:
1. пришел человек без каких либо знаний предмета
2. человек без знания области
3. человек САМ не потратил ни одной секунды на то, что бы найти любой электронный учебник в сети и прочитать его (серия "сайты для чайников"

4. "не бухает в подворотне - и то молодец." - не аргумент. так же как насильника оправдывать "не педофил - и то молодец". я к тому, что если что-то чуть лучше, чем самое плохое, то оно не станет хорошим. 9 меньше 10, но никогда не станет 1.
5. нужен наставник в прямой досягаемости подзатыльника. а это сразу отметает форумы как источник каких либо знаний. почему? - см п.1-3
70 повідомлень
#14 років тому
Строите из себя касту обладающую тайными знаниямипора смириться с тем что мы следующий виток ремесленников.
1809 повідомлень
5330 повідомлень
#14 років тому
Цитата ("Vasiletc"):пора смириться с тем что мы следующий виток ремесленников.
угу, следующим витком становятся как только опыта наберется лет 5, но не только колупания джумлы, а что нить на порядок серьезного.
и даже после этого будут люди, которые на порядок опытнее просто по тому что пока low программеры изучали какой нить фреймворк мидл уже стали топ, а топы стали ПМ или CEO.
всегда есть "пищевая цепочка"
212 повідомлень
#14 років тому
Morbo12, все верно: Руби мало используется в России (хотя набирает обороты), php оч сильно популярен и не будет проблем с хостигом (да и с Руби их нет - VPS все решает).Не хочу поднимать холивары, что лучше - PHP или Руби. Скажу одно: когда я только начинал под web делать приложения (пришел в WEB с разработки на С++), я выбрал php - оч быстро освоился ) Немного поработав с php, стал смотреть в сторону Руби - по началу исключительно ради интереса. Но теперь понимаю, что все верно сделал, изучив Руби и рельсы.
morbo12, можно долго рассуждать, что лучше - Django vs Rails, PHP vs Ruby, но нужно просто брать и делать )
235 повідомлень
#14 років тому
Цитата ("MaratMaratMarat"):Django vs Rails, PHP vs Ruby
я конечно все понимаю, но почему никто не предложил до сих пор не учить php, ruby или asp.net, а сразу начать с node.js и javascript под него?
Ведь тенденция к тому что в скором будущем он станет популярным, конечно тенденчия сегодня есть, а завтро всякое может быть...
Цитата ("Vasiletc"):
мы следующий виток ремесленников
Зачетная фраза, я даже записал себе на память